how many electoral votes are needed to win the presidential election?

Respuesta :

ryane090708 ryane090708
  • 15-10-2021

Answer:

you need 270 votes

Explanation:

A candidate must receive an absolute majority of electoral votes (currently 270) to win the presidency or the vice presidency.
